Recognizing Cold Laser Treatment



Cold laser treatment, also referred to as low-level laser therapy (LLLT), is a cutting-edge approach to hair restoration that utilizes particular wavelengths of light to boost hair follicles. This non-invasive therapy advertises hair growth by enhancing cellular activity and enhancing blood circulation in the scalp.

When you undertake this therapy, you'll notice that the low-level laser light passes through the skin, stimulating the hair roots and encouraging them to get in the growth phase of the hair cycle.

You could ask yourself exactly how this procedure works. The light sent out during the therapy turns on the mitochondria within your cells, improving energy manufacturing and advertising the recovery procedure. Because of this, your hair follicles can recoup from any type of damages, bring about healthier hair growth.

This therapy is usually painless and requires no downtime, making it a hassle-free choice for many people seeking hair reconstruction.

Normal sessions can aid you accomplish the most effective results, as uniformity is key in reaping the benefits of cold laser therapy. With each session, you're providing your hair roots the support they need to flourish, leading to thicker, fuller hair gradually.

Suggested Therapy Schedules



When planning your treatment timetable for hair restoration, uniformity is key to attaining ideal outcomes. Many specialists suggest beginning with 3 sessions per week for the very first month. This constant treatment helps start the hair repair procedure by promoting hair roots and promoting circulation in the scalp.

As you progress, you can progressively lower the regularity to two sessions each week for the complying with two to three months. This adjustment enables your scalp to proceed gaining from the therapy while offering you some versatility in your timetable.


After this initial period, many find that once-a-week sessions can keep the outcomes you've accomplished, particularly if you're combining cold laser treatment with various other hair remediation strategies.

Constantly listen to your body; if you feel any kind of pain or do not see outcomes, consult your doctor for personalized suggestions. Tracking your progression can additionally aid you identify if modifications to your routine are essential.
